Jawen

The tiny rock ensemble Jawen formed throughout the core of brothers Nicolas and Olivier Jawen. Hailing from Evreux in Normandy, the brothers spent period learning and playing overseas (Nicolas in the U.S.; Olivier in the U.K.) before merging pushes in Paris in 2006. Pursuing time spent back Normandy, the duo released its debut, Two, in 2008. Using a focus on performing in British and a intentionally retro appeal located in shore rock and roll and blues, the record gained some achievement but didn’t garner much interest in European countries. After signing up for Believe Information, the band started work on a fresh record with an intentional concentrate on the U.S. marketplace (pursuing in the footsteps of Phoenix) and a solid sense of international curiosity about American rock and roll (not really unlike Japan’s Fukumimi), culminating in 2010’s 1, 2, 2 Is certainly Five.
